The garage occupancy feed for the Brindlewood campus arrives over a message queue every thirty seconds, one record per level, published by the Stallgrid edge boxes. Counts can briefly go negative when a sensor double-fires on exit; the ingest job clamps these to zero and flags the interval. If the feed stalls for more than five minutes, the dashboard falls back to the last known snapshot. Sensor mappings, queue names, and the replay procedure are documented on the internal page below.

runbook for tahog-kadug: https://gitlab.qirvanworks.corp/projects/pages/view/b139298aed28

Finance Review Summary — Customer Concentration, Verelux Group

Revenue concentration remains elevated: the Dunmoor account represents 31% of recurring income, up from 26% last year. Two further accounts together add 18%. Contract renewal timing clusters in the second quarter, compounding exposure. Heads of department should factor this into hiring and inventory commitments. Mitigation options are under review, and the confidential note below sets out the plan.

internal memo for faweg-hahip: Silokix Works plans to lower the Tamvan list price by 8 percent in June.

### Runbook: Account recovery — Giftpost receipt mailer

If the Giftpost mailer account gets locked mid-release (usually after three bad SMTP auth attempts), don't panic — receipts queue safely for 48 hours. Hit the Warblehook admin console, pick "Recover service account," and confirm you're on the release rotation. The console will prompt for the mailer's recovery passphrase before re-issuing credentials. For release managers, it's kept here:

strongbox words: gilok-druion-briath-wendor-briion-prawyn-fenion-oliir-casdor-holius-briius-gilath-gilael-pelys

## Step 4: Cut over the tile cache

Mapleframe's tile-rendering cache layer now runs as its own service, Slatecache, instead of the in-process LRU used by the old Atlasworks renderer. Drain the legacy cache first by setting the renderer to passthrough mode, then deploy Slatecache to the same zone as the tile workers to keep latency low. Once it reports healthy, point the renderer at it using the settings below.

config for tawif-bagef:
[sorwyn]
team = sorys
access_code = ac_9ba40c
host = sorwyn.ordingrid.local
port = 5000
owner = aldok.quenion
peer = belath.paliqcloud.local